Atletico Madrid hosts Mallorca on Friday in a top-flight Spanish La Liga fixture. Atletico is in third place in La Liga with a record of 21-7-5 on 59 points, but 12 points adrift of first-place Real Madrid. Atletico is unbeaten in 11 consecutive matches in La Liga action after a late equalizer gave them a 2-2 draw against Barcelona on Tuesday night. Saul Niguez scored a pair of goals from the penalty spot for Atletico as the capital side continues its fight for Champions League qualification.

Atletico Madrid on its home pitch has not lost since the beginning of December in league action. Over its most recent five matches played Atletico has 4 wins and 1 draw to take 13 of 15 points. Atletico has scored 11 goals and its backline and goalkeepers have allowed just three goals in those five matches, including three clean sheets. Alvaro Morata is the leading goal scorer for Atletico with nine, while Angel Correa is the assists leader with six. 

Mallorca is battling against relegation and currently sits in 18th place in the La Liga table. Mallorca is five points shy of safety and will have its hands full on the road against Atletico on Friday. Mallorca is 8-5-20 on 29 points. Los Bermellones played exceptionally well in their last outing thumping Celta Vigo 5-1. The victory was Mallorca’s first since returning from the lockdown on hiatus but that was on its home pitch and on the road Mallorca has the worst record in the top-flight having lost 13 of it's 16 matches .

Mallorca has one win, one draw and three losses over its most recent five fixtures in the legal action. Over that span of five matches, Mallorca has scored 7 goals, of which 5 came in a rout of Celta Vigo Tuesday night, and the back line and goalkeepers have allowed eight goals.. Ante Budimir is the leading goal scorer for Mallorca with 12, while Takefusa Kubo is the assists leader with four.

Atletico was victorious 2-0 in the reverse match between the two played in September of last year. However, over the previous four matches head to head the two have each won one and two have ended in draws.  Nevertheless, Atletico is playing much better at this point then is Mallorca having gone unbeaten on its home pitch since December of last year and unbeaten in each of its last 11 fixtures overall.
